Duck Trio Open Oregon Amateur Match Play

BEND, Ore. ? In Wednesday’s opening round of match play in the 99th Oregon Women’s Amateur tournament, sophomore Kate Hildahl and freshmen Monika Graf and Tiffany Schoning continued action in the Bend Golf and Country Club-hosted event.
The top seed Hildahl opened with a 4-and-3 win over Elizabeth Jarrett of Bend, Ore., and now faces Avery Sills of Portland in Thursday’s quarterfinals.
Schoning lost Wednesday’s contest vs. Sills, 1-up, while Graf was edged by Karly Mills of McMinnville, 4 and 2.
Former Duck coach Lara Tennant also advanced to Thursday’s action with a 2-up win over Jordan Allyne of Bellevue, Wash.
In the previous two days’ stroke play qualifying, the Tualatin native Hildahl (74-76-150) led the field by two strokes, and Graf followed another stroke back in third place for the second consecutive day (75-78-153). Tennant (78-76) followed in a three-way tie for fourth place at 154, six strokes ahead of Schoning (17th-tie, 83-77-160).
Looking ahead, the six-day tournament continues with Thursday’s quarterfinal match play round on the on the par 72, 5,947-yard course. The tourney championship round is set for Saturday, June 21.
